Web14 jun. 2024 · encode the input string to binary code (compressed) by using the huffman code map. Use a for loop to go through each character in the string, use it as key to get the code from the map, concatenate them as output binary string. Decode the binary code to the original string (uncompressed) by using the binary tree.
Huffman Coding with C program for text compression Medium
WebLe codage de Huffman est un algorithme de compression de données sans perte.Le codage de Huffman utilise un code à longueur variable pour représenter un symbole de … Web17 jun. 2024 · 赫夫曼树的构建步骤如下: 1、将给定的n个权值看做n棵只有根节点(无左右孩子)的二叉树,组成一个集合HT,每棵树的权值为该节点的权值。 2、从集合HT中选出2棵权值最小的二叉树,组成一棵新的二叉树,其权值为这2棵二叉树的权值之和。 3、将步骤2中选出的2棵二叉树从集合HT中删去,同时将步骤2中新得到的二叉树加入到集合HT中 … charish gozon-cenita federis
An Adaptive Huffman Decoding Algorithm for MP3 Decoder
WebCanonical Huffman codes address these two issues by generating the codes in a clear standardized format; all the codes for a given length are assigned their values … WebHuffman invented a greedy algorithm that creates an optimal prefix code called a Huffman Code. The algorithm builds the tree T analogous to the optimal code in a bottom-up manner. It starts with a set of C leaves (C is the number of characters) and performs C - 1 'merging' operations to create the final tree. WebHuffman Encoding/Decoding encode decode Most Popular Tools Business Card Generator Color Palette Generator Favicon Generator Flickr RSS Feed Generator IMG2TXT Logo Maker All Tools Biorhythms Business Card Generator Color Palette Generator Color Picker Comic Strip Maker Crapola Translator Favicon Generator Flickr RSS Feed Generator … charish hammond